Wave Rock and Aboriginal Caves (FWR):

Wave Rock is one of Australia’s most famous landforms. A giant multicoloured granite wave towering 15m into the air appears to be about to crash into the bush land below. Scientists have established that Wave Rock dates back to at least 2,700 million years.
